The influencer must appear on May 27 before the Prosecutor’s Office specialized in gambling. They accuse her of spreading unauthorized platforms to operate in Argentina.
The media Cinthia Fernández was summoned to investigation by the Prosecutor Specialized in Games of Chance (FEJA)who investigates his alleged participation in the promotion of illegal bets through your Instagram account. The call call was set for the Tuesday, May 27 at 11and must appear in person.

The investigation is in charge of the prosecutor Juan Rozaswho drives a series of actions to combat the illegal online game, especially the one that circulates without authorization in The Autonomous City of Buenos Aires. The cause began after a complaint filed by the Lottery of the City of Buenos Airesheaded by Jesús Acevedofrom Fernández’s recent publications on his social networks.


As detailed by judicial sources, the publications of the exmodel and influencer promoted Betting platforms without a license to operate in any jurisdiction of the countrywhich would violate the Article 301 bis of the Argentine Criminal Codewho foresees sentences between 3 and 6 years in prison for this type of crime.
In addition, Fernández’s behavior would also have violated the Law 6,330that regulates the Pathological game prevention In the city of Buenos Aires. According to the spokesmen of the case, the influencer spread testimonies of alleged winners thanking him for bringing them closer to these sites, a message that “It encourages game as a personal success and creates false expectations”, They said.
The magnifying glass on influencers
The city lottery carries out a strategy for track and report influencers that promote illegal betting houses, even in content aimed at Children or adolescents audiences. According to official data, More than 100 content creators They are being investigated for similar events.
From the prosecution they explained that the objective is protect users, especially minorsof the risks of the non -regulated online game. The legal procedure, based on the Criminal Procedure Code of the city, contemplates the possibility of moving towards an oral trial if the crime is verified.
For now, Cinthia Fernández must give explanations before justice. His defense has not yet made public statements.
